What affects the price

When you budget for new windows, several factors change the final number. The material you choose—like vinyl, wood, or fiberglass—is usually the biggest driver. You will also see price shifts based on the style of window, such as double-hung versus large picture windows, and the specific energy-efficiency ratings you select. What is involved in bay window installation?

Bay window installation creates a projecting window structure that extends outward from the main wall of a house. This process involves modifying the wall to accommodate the extended frame and installing the multi-panel window unit. Proper structural support and sealing are essential to ensure the window is secure and weather-tight. Licensed pros handle these complexities.
